Is Park Creek Apartments Safe?

It's average — crime is comparable to the national average. Park Creek Apartments in Charlotte, NC has a safety grade of C. The overall crime index is 162, which is 62% above the national average of 100.

Compared to the Charlotte average (crime index 115), Park Creek Apartments is 47%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.

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 190, 90%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 111).
